Evaluating Roundness Errors by Cross-chords Algorithm

A cross-chords algorithm for evaluating roundness errors is proposed in the paper, at the same time, mathematical models and formulas as well as the steps to calculate the centers of reference circles in high accuracy are showed. Three reference circles(Maximum inscribed circle-MIC, Minimum zone reference circle-MZC, and Minimum circumscribed circle-MCC) for evaluating roundness errors can be calculated by the formulas deduced in the paper after several times
